Output 59890c275191c3651d44cc8704c815966526023510aa37605acbf3327fb07956:0

value
25213700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 632a69ea5ae83330c14d84223a951ee5613db45c OP_EQUAL
address
3AjMdVXqvYUYJpFU6Ru5XnoQ1fX7gFGEiu
transaction
59890c275191c3651d44cc8704c815966526023510aa37605acbf3327fb07956
spent
true